So, here's how the groups were divided and the names of the final 24 acts…

Cheryl has the girls category and was the first judge to choose her final six. They are: Lola Saunders, Lauren Platt, Kerrianne Covell, Stephanie Nala, Emily Middlemass and Chloe Jasmin.

Mel B has the boys and her final six are: Jake Quickenden, Jordan Morris, Danny Dearden, Paul Akister, Jack Walton and Andrea Faustini.

Simon Cowell got the over-25s and his final six are: Jay James, Ben Haenow, Fleur East, Stevi Ritchie, Helen Fulthorpe and Lizzy Pattinson.

Louis Walsh has the groups, including a new boy group and a new girl group. Both new groups are, so far, nameless, having just been formed from solo singers who failed the auditions. Louis’ four other groups are: The Brooks, Blonde Electric, Only The Young and Concept.
